Original vintage program from the Hollywood Victory Caravan, for a star-studded performance at Loew’s Capital Theatre, in Washington, D. C., on April 30, 1942, 9 x 12, 32 pages. Signed in pencil on the two-page inside gatefold, “Ben Siegel.” Gatefold is also signed and inscribed in blue and black ink to Charles Boyer, some using a nickname of “Beans,” by 14 other celebrities, including Arleen Whelan, Frances Gifford, Marie McDonald, Juanita Stark, Fay McKenzie, Katherine Booth, and Elyse Knox.

Of the 24 Hollywood stars who performed at this event, 22 of them have also signed and inscribed to Boyer next to their respective images throughout the program. Signers are: Stan Laurel, Oliver Hardy, Bert Lahr, Cary Grant, Groucho Marx, Bing Crosby, Bob Hope, Desi Arnaz, Joan Bennett, Joan Blondell, James Cagney, Claudette Colbert, Jerry Colonna, Charlotte Greenwood, Olivia deHavilland, Frances Langford, Frank McHugh, Ray Middleton, Merle Oberon, Pat O’Brien, Eleanor Powell, and Rise Stevens. Scattered creasing and handling wear, otherwise fine condition.
